LMC is a 370-bed major teaching hospital that has been recognized for excellence in the 2025-2026 U.S. News & World Report Best Hospitals report among the top hospitals in the Philadelphia region for exceptional patient care. LMC offers a comprehensive range of primary care, disease prevention, and specialized medical and surgical services, including advanced treatments in cardiovascular, cancer care, maternity, orthopedics, and a level II trauma center. LMC supports complex care treatment through a wide range of specialty care. A leader in medical education, LMC trains a diverse group of residents and fellows participating in various programs across multiple specialties. The hospital is also home to the Lankenau Institute for Medical Research, where groundbreaking research advances the detection, diagnosis, and treatment of diseases and offers access to clinical trials.
